Knuckle Sandwich is a recurring ability in the franchise.
Appearances
Dragon Quest VI
Knuckle Sandwich inflicts double damage, but has a chance to miss outright. Carver obtains this ability during a story even in Murdaw's Keep.. Other characters can learn this ability by advancing to rank 5 of the Martial Artist vocation.
Dragon Quest VII
Carbon copy of VI's.
Dragon Quest VIII
Knuckle Sandwich is a fisticuffs technique that the Hero, Yangus, and Angelo can learn. It requires 12 skill points by Yangus, 24 skill points by the Hero, and 35 skill points by Angelo. Slightly weaker than before--damage is +50% instead of double.
Dragon Quest IX
This ability is learned with 25 skill points invested into Fisticuffs skill. Damage is base attack + 50%, with no additional chance to miss. Costs 2 MP to use.
